File: org-roam-node.el.html

This module is dedicated for Org-roam nodes and its components. It provides standard means to interface with them, both programmatically and interactively.

Defined variables (15)

org-roam-bracket-completion-reRegex for completion within link brackets.
org-roam-completion-everywhereWhen non-nil, provide link completion matching outside of Org links.
org-roam-completion-functionsList of functions to be used with ‘completion-at-point’ for Org-roam.
org-roam-extract-new-file-pathThe file path template to use when a node is extracted to its own file.
org-roam-link-auto-replaceIf non-nil, replace "roam:" links to existing nodes with "id:" links.
org-roam-link-typeLink type for org-roam nodes.
org-roam-node-annotation-functionThis function used to attach annotations for ‘org-roam-node-read’.
org-roam-node-default-sortDefault sort order for Org-roam node completions.
org-roam-node-display-templateConfigures display formatting for Org-roam node.
org-roam-node-formatterThe link description for node insertion.
org-roam-node-historyMinibuffer history of nodes.
org-roam-node-template-prefixesPrefixes for each of the node’s properties.
org-roam-ref-annotation-functionThis function used to attach annotations for ‘org-roam-ref-read’.
org-roam-ref-historyMinibuffer history of refs.
org-roam-ref-prompt-functionFunction to prompt for ref strings in ‘org-roam-ref-add’.

Defined functions (87)

org-roam--buffer-promoteable-p()
org-roam--format-nodes-using-function(NODES)
org-roam--format-nodes-using-template(NODES)
org-roam--get-titles()
org-roam--h1-count()
org-roam--promote-entire-buffer-internal()
org-roam--register-completion-functions-h()
org-roam--replace-roam-links-on-save-h()
org-roam-alias-add(ALIAS)
org-roam-complete-everywhere()
org-roam-complete-link-at-point()
org-roam-demote-entire-buffer()
org-roam-extract-subtree()
org-roam-link-follow-link(TITLE-OR-ALIAS)
org-roam-link-replace-all()
org-roam-link-replace-at-point(&optional LINK)
org-roam-node--format-entry(TEMPLATE NODE &optional WIDTH)
org-roam-node--process-display-format(FORMAT)
org-roam-node-aliases(org-roam-node-aliases X)
org-roam-node-aliases--inliner(INLINE--FORM X)
org-roam-node-at-point(&optional ASSERT)
org-roam-node-category(ARG &rest ARGS)
org-roam-node-create
org-roam-node-create--cmacro
org-roam-node-create-from-db(TITLE ALIASES ID FILE FILE-TITLE LEVEL TODO POINT PRIORITY SCHEDULED DEADLINE PROPERTIES OLP FILE-ATIME FILE-MTIME TAGS REFS)
org-roam-node-create-from-db--cmacro(CL-WHOLE-ARG TITLE ALIASES ID FILE FILE-TITLE LEVEL TODO POINT PRIORITY SCHEDULED DEADLINE PROPERTIES OLP FILE-ATIME FILE-MTIME TAGS REFS)
org-roam-node-deadline(org-roam-node-deadline X)
org-roam-node-deadline--inliner(INLINE--FORM X)
org-roam-node-file(org-roam-node-file X)
org-roam-node-file--inliner(INLINE--FORM X)
org-roam-node-file-atime(org-roam-node-file-atime X)
org-roam-node-file-hash(org-roam-node-file-hash X)
org-roam-node-file-hash--inliner(INLINE--FORM X)
org-roam-node-file-mtime(org-roam-node-file-mtime X)
org-roam-node-file-mtime--inliner(INLINE--FORM X)
org-roam-node-file-title(org-roam-node-file-title X)
org-roam-node-file-title--inliner(INLINE--FORM X)
org-roam-node-find
org-roam-node-formatted(ARG &rest ARGS)
org-roam-node-from-id(ID)
org-roam-node-from-ref(REF)
org-roam-node-from-title-or-alias(S &optional NOCASE)
org-roam-node-id(org-roam-node-id X)
org-roam-node-id--inliner(INLINE--FORM X)
org-roam-node-insert
org-roam-node-level(org-roam-node-level X)
org-roam-node-level--inliner(INLINE--FORM X)
org-roam-node-list()
org-roam-node-marker(NODE)
org-roam-node-olp(org-roam-node-olp X)
org-roam-node-olp--inliner(INLINE--FORM X)
org-roam-node-open(NODE &optional CMD FORCE)
org-roam-node-p(X)
org-roam-node-p--inliner(INLINE--FORM X)
org-roam-node-point(org-roam-node-point X)
org-roam-node-point--inliner(INLINE--FORM X)
org-roam-node-priority(org-roam-node-priority X)
org-roam-node-priority--inliner(INLINE--FORM X)
org-roam-node-properties(org-roam-node-properties X)
org-roam-node-properties--inliner(INLINE--FORM X)
org-roam-node-random(&optional OTHER-WINDOW FILTER-FN)
org-roam-node-read(&optional INITIAL-INPUT FILTER-FN SORT-FN REQUIRE-MATCH PROMPT)
org-roam-node-read--annotation(NODE)
org-roam-node-read--completions(&optional FILTER-FN SORT-FN)
org-roam-node-read--to-candidate(NODE TEMPLATE)
org-roam-node-read-sort-by-file-atime(COMPLETION-A COMPLETION-B)
org-roam-node-read-sort-by-file-mtime(COMPLETION-A COMPLETION-B)
org-roam-node-refs--inliner(INLINE--FORM X)
org-roam-node-scheduled(org-roam-node-scheduled X)
org-roam-node-scheduled--inliner(INLINE--FORM X)
org-roam-node-slug(ARG &rest ARGS)
org-roam-node-tags(org-roam-node-tags X)
org-roam-node-tags--inliner(INLINE--FORM X)
org-roam-node-title(org-roam-node-title X)
org-roam-node-title--inliner(INLINE--FORM X)
org-roam-node-todo(org-roam-node-todo X)
org-roam-node-todo--inliner(INLINE--FORM X)
org-roam-node-visit(NODE &optional OTHER-WINDOW FORCE)
org-roam-ref-add(REF)
org-roam-ref-find(&optional INITIAL-INPUT FILTER-FN)
org-roam-ref-read--annotation(REF)
org-roam-ref-read--completions()
org-roam-ref-remove(&optional REF)
org-roam-refile(NODE)
org-roam-tag-add(TAGS)
org-roam-tag-completions()
org-roam-tag-remove(&optional TAGS)

Defined faces (0)